In all the excitement of planning for your wedding, don't forget to take care of the business details by finding out Minneapolis marriage license requirements. A marriage ceremony can't take place unless a valid marriage license has been issued and you won't be able to apply for it after the ceremony.

Details may vary by county, so it is best to check with your local county Register of Deeds office. A selection of local counties with their contact information is listed below. Both applicants should appear at the Register of Deeds to get a marriage license. Both parties must be at least 18 years old to be legally married. If one or both of the applicants is under legal age, parental consent must be obtained (contact Register of Deeds for additional information). Be prepared to pay a license fee.

WHAT SHOULD I BRING?

  • Social Security Number (provide proof with a W-2 form, payroll stub or statement from the Social Security Office)
  • Proper Identification (Drivers License)
  • Birth Certificate
  • The license fee is $100, (cash only).

There is a mandatory 5 day waiting period for a Minnesota marriage license, but you can get married immediately after receiving the license. Be sure to allow adequate time for marriage license processing.
